I'm new here, and I'm also a newbie dashcamer. A month ago I bought an F770 with 2nd camera and hardwiring. Because I don't have my own garage, outside is below 0°C and I also haven't enough experience with electronic installations in cars, I let a local company install it. It took them 2,5 hours with hardwiring and camera positioning. The guys who made the installation said, the wires are connected directly to the back of the fuse box. The car is 2012 Skoda Fabia II (5J), what is technically something like VW Polo/Club.
First everything seemed ok, but when I checked the memory card after few days, it seems, the cameras are always in continuous recording mode, and it doesn't switching to parking mode. When the engine is started, the voltage is around 14,0-14,4 V, when it's off, it is around 12,2-12,3 V. My question is: what's wrong?
Thank you for your help.
P.s.: Firmware is updated (v1.00.06).
